trunking [ˈtrʌŋkɪŋ]
n
1. (Electronics & Computer Science / Telecommunications) Telecomm the cables that take a common route through an exchange building linking ranks of selectors
2. (Miscellaneous Technologies / Building) plastic housing used to conceal wires, etc.; casing
3. (Business / Commerce) the delivery of goods over long distances, esp by road vehicles to local distribution centres, from which deliveries and collections are made
